HCM City seeks state funding for three hospitals

HCM City is seeking government funding of around VND4.5 trillion (USD193.96 million) for three local hospitals.

Under the proposal sent to the Ministry of Health and the Ministry of Planning and Investment, the funding will be used for the equipment purchase at three general hospitals which are being constructed in Hoc Mon, Cu Chi and Thu Duc districts.
 

The projects with a total investment capital of VND5.6 trillion are scheduled to be completed in 2023.

HCM City has also proposed a list of 184 projects to upgrade and build medical facilities in wards and communes with a total investment capital of VND2 trillion to the Ministry of Health and the Ministry of Planning and Investment.

Earlier, the government agreed to grant HCM City VND2.5 trillion (USD109 million) to improve traffic infrastructure, its environment and VND283 billion to rebuild HCM City Children's Hospital.
